5/31/2010 - Chemo regiment #2 begins
Hair loss is the latest change. The time finally came to take it down. It's a lot chillier now! Today is the beginning of regiment 2 (of 4). This is a 5 day stay at Evergreen Medical where they will administer short doses of chemo daily, ending with a spinal tap/chemo infusion on Friday. This spinal tap of chemo is given to keep the lymphoma out of the spinal column and brain. As much as I don't care for spinal taps, I'll grudgingly accept this one with open arms.
